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E A worm drive is disclosed for adjusting the angular position of vertical lamella blinds, the worm drive comprises a vertical shaft, arranged inside a lamella carrier housing, which shaft carries a pinion torsionally connected thereto, and has one end joined to a lamella of the blind. A worm gear, driven by a drive shaft, engages with the pinion. The worm drive of the invention is characterized by a worm gear having an axial center opening and held by a snap-on sleeve on a hub disposed in the lamella carrier. The worm gear is provided with a series of indentations that engage with cams arranged on the outside circumference of the snap-on sleeve so as to form a friction clutch that allows over rotation of the drive shaft without damaging the components of the worm drive. The construction of the worm drive of the invention significantly simplifies assembly, and reduces the structural depth of the lamella carrier housing.
